COLUMBUS - Federal and state wildlife officials working in conjunction with academic researchers today announced six water samples taken from Sandusky and north Maumee bays tested positive for the presence of Asian carp environmental DNA in Michigan and Ohio waters.

6/29/2012
ATHENS, OH – For the second year in a row, more than 100 bobcats have been shown to be living in Ohio’s southeastern counties with the confirmation of 136 sightings by state wildlife officials during 2011, according to the Ohio Department of Natural Resources’ (ODNR) Division of Wildlife. The reports show an increase from the 106 verified sightings in 2010.
